How To Select Shower Head By Its Nozzles?

The arrangement, angle, number and aperture of the water nozzles will also directly affect the water outlet experience of the shower. Because the internal structure is invisible, the arrangement of the water nozzles cannot be quantitatively evaluated. Here we focus on the aperture and number of the water nozzles.

Number of water nozzles: Under the same shower head diameter, if the number of water nozzles is too small, although the pressure can be better, the cleaning area is small or the water column is prone to hollow in a large range, which affects the cleaning effect of the shower. If there are many water outlet holes, or the design of the water outlet holes is very small, such as less than 0.3, otherwise it is easy to have weak water outlet, which will also affect the cleaning effect. In addition, if the water outlet is less than 0.3MM, it can only be directly covered with the opening, which is difficult to design as a soft glue nozzle. In this case, the water quality is too hard and it is easy to cause the water nozzle to be blocked, and cleaning is troublesome. Therefore, the number and arrangement angle of the water nozzles need to be reasonably designed in combination with the diameter of the cover to ensure that the water outlet area is sufficient and the water outlet strength is good.

Outlet aperture: At present, the mainstream apertures on the market can be divided into three types
1. The apertures of the water outlet are all above 1.0MM. For example, Hansgrohe’s Raindance and Rainstorm will spray a larger amount of water. When the water pressure at the home is relatively high, the water from the shower with poor structural design will be heavy and some will feel tingling. In this state, the bathing experience will be very bad, especially if the skin is relatively delicate Children will feel uncomfortable, but the well-designed shower is full of water, and the cleaning and wrapping is in place. It is very easy to use for friends who like high-flow showers; but when the water pressure at the home is small, the shower with a large aperture will emit water. It is relatively soft and weak, the spray distance is short, and the shower experience is very general. The advantages of this type of soft glue nozzle with a larger aperture: it is relatively easy to block, if there is a blockage, the soft glue nozzle can generally be solved by rubbing it. The disadvantage is that the water outlet aperture is relatively large, the water outlet will be relatively weak and use a lot of water; and the number of water outlet holes arranged on the shower surface of the same diameter is relatively small, in this case, the coverage of the cleaning spray density will be sparse, and sometimes the cleaning efficiency It will be slower and more water-intensive.
2. Ultra-fine hard-hole faucets with a diameter of 0.3MM or less: showers with such diameters can be defined as ultra-fine sprays. The following Japanese-style ultra-fine showers and ultra-fine showers with stainless steel cover are common, with average apertures. At 0.3MM, the water outlet holes are extremely fine, which can play a good supercharging effect and can better solve the problem of low water pressure. However, the shortcomings of this type of shower are also obvious. The extremely fine hard-hole nozzles are easy to block, especially in areas with relatively hard water quality in China, such as the north, under normal use, one-third of the water nozzles may be blocked within a month (measured use ), it is very inconvenient to clean up after it is blocked. The advantage of this type of shower head is that the water outlet aperture is relatively small, and the shower head with the same diameter will have more water outlet holes. In the case of many water outlet columns, the cleaning coverage density will be higher, and the cleaning efficiency will be higher while saving water and pressurizing. high.
3. The diameter of the water nozzle is 0.4-0.5MM soft glue nozzle: this type of aperture shower can be defined as a fine spray, which is basically a shower newly developed in recent years. The big spray is much thinner, which can have a good supercharging effect. At the same time, the faucet is made of silica gel, and the aperture is relatively large (compared to the 0.3MM ultra-fine spray), which is not easy to block the hole and is easy to clean. It can be solved. This type of shower is the mainstream type of shower at present, and the water output effect is generally not bad. However, to design a shower that has both good pressure and a soft water discharge experience, it requires R&D personnel to have excellent design capabilities and rich practical design experience, and also requires a bit of luck.
